你提到的“数据库excel”可能是指将Excel文件中的数据导入到数据库中,或者将数据库中的数据导出到Excel文件中。这两种操作都可以通过编程或使用现有的工具来完成。
将Excel数据导入数据库1. 使用Python编程: 可以使用`pandas`和`sqlalchemy`库来读取Excel文件并将其数据导入到数据库中。 示例代码: ```python import pandas as pd from sqlalchemy import create_engine
创建数据库引擎 engine = create_engine
读取Excel文件 df = pd.read_excel
将数据导入数据库 df.to_sql ```
2. 使用Excel的“数据”功能: 打开Excel文件,选择“数据”选项卡,然后选择“从其他源”。 选择“从SQL Server”或其他数据库类型,然后按照提示输入服务器名、数据库名等信息。 选择需要导入的表,然后点击“完成”导入数据。
将数据库数据导出到Excel1. 使用Python编程: 同样可以使用`pandas`和`sqlalchemy`库来查询数据库并将结果导出到Excel文件中。 示例代码: ```python import pandas as pd from sqlalchemy import create_engine
创建数据库引擎 engine = create_engine
查询数据库 df = pd.read_sql
将数据导出到Excel文件 df.to_excel ```
2. 使用数据库管理工具: 许多数据库管理工具(如SQL Server Management Studio、MySQL Workbench等)都提供了将查询结果导出到Excel的功能。 在工具中执行查询,然后选择导出选项,选择Excel格式并指定文件路径。
这些方法可以根据你的具体需求和技术背景来选择使用。如果你需要更详细的指导或具体的代码示例,请提供更多信息。
数据库与Excel:高效数据管理的桥梁
在当今数据驱动的世界中,数据库和Excel都是数据处理和管理的基石。数据库提供了强大的数据存储、检索和管理功能,而Excel则以其直观的界面和丰富的功能在数据分析中占据重要地位。本文将探讨数据库与Excel之间的联系,以及如何利用它们实现高效的数据管理。
一、数据库与Excel的各自优势
数据库,如MySQL、Oracle等,擅长处理大规模数据,支持复杂查询和事务处理。它们提供数据完整性、安全性和并发控制,适合企业级应用。
Excel,作为一款电子表格软件,以其易用性和灵活性著称。它适合小到中等规模的数据处理,便于数据可视化、分析和报告生成。
二、数据库与Excel的交互方式
1. 数据导入导出
通过SQL查询导出数据到Excel,或者使用Excel的“获取外部数据”功能导入数据库数据。
2. ODBC/JDBC连接
使用ODBC或JDBC连接数据库,通过编程方式读取和写入数据。
3. VBA编程
利用Excel的VBA宏功能,编写脚本实现与数据库的交互。
三、Excel在数据库管理中的应用
1. 数据分析
通过Excel的数据透视表、图表等功能,对数据库中的数据进行深入分析。
2. 报表生成
利用Excel的格式化和布局功能,生成美观、专业的报表。
3. 数据清洗和转换
在Excel中处理数据,如删除重复项、转换数据格式等,然后导入数据库。
四、数据库与Excel的整合策略
1. 数据同步
定期同步数据库和Excel中的数据,确保数据的一致性。
2. 数据安全
在数据库和Excel中设置权限控制,防止数据泄露。
3. 自动化操作
利用VBA、Power Query等工具实现自动化操作,提高工作效率。
数据库与Excel是高效数据管理的桥梁。通过合理利用它们的优势,我们可以实现数据的存储、处理和分析,为业务决策提供有力支持。在数据驱动的时代,掌握数据库与Excel的交互技巧,将有助于我们在职场中脱颖而出。